Transaction c6077408e1cad444302c13569fedf36df106de395ee258fb5ac9d20b95d433ed
1 Input
-
be8d8815910307ce5158826043fde192d466ad51b027853798863ba8a42f4a77:54
OP_DATA_48(48) 4402202a12228d5daa6ebb81aaa947ea5852223eaf0db246a5a8df5898fb40c26ef4d8022006ddfa5447b65a2fab128e
1 Outputs
- c6077408e1cad444302c13569fedf36df106de395ee258fb5ac9d20b95d433ed:0
value 10285593
address 3HweiCRebYRjJm22fsHDUKtbE8EWuGumqE